What is the primary purpose of secondary air in combustion?

The primary purpose of secondary air in combustion is to improve burn efficiency. Secondary air is introduced into the combustion process after the initial burning phase, facilitating the complete oxidation of fuel. By providing additional oxygen, secondary air helps ensure that any unburned hydrocarbons are fully combusted, resulting in a more complete and efficient burn. This process not only enhances fuel efficiency but also reduces the formation of pollutants such as carbon monoxide and unburned particulate matter.

While enhancing flame color, controlling temperature, or creating a larger flame may relate to different aspects of combustion, these are not the main focus of secondary air. The effectiveness of secondary air primarily centers around facilitating a more complete and efficient combustion process.
